Default walnut back thickness

How thin can I safely get on the back with walnut? I got some from a friend and its really thin. I've sanded it down to around 0.100 and not all the saw marks are quite out yet.

I built mine with the back between .085 and .090 (a little thin for me), but I've had no problems. Admittedly it was straight-grained black walnut, not an off quarter or curly piece, but I think you could get it at least .10 thinner with no effect.
